Opera Garnier, like the little Palace of Versailles in Paris
Opera Garnier is a representative building built in the neo-Baroque style, combining the baroque and rococo styles, the ultimate in splendor. The theater's Chagall ceiling painting 'The Bouquet of Dreams' was wonderful and grand enough to be counted among the numerous works of art that I saw while traveling in Europe. The interior is decorated with golden light and beautiful paintings and sculptures, making it a very luxurious palace.
Among the operas, the Chagall ceiling painting inside the theater is the highlight, and it can only be seen when there are no performances. The interesting point of the theater is the 5th box seat. In the Phantom of the Opera, the place where the ghost warned to always be empty is actually marked and left empty each time.
